i spilled juice on my keyboard and when i did i instantly unplugged it and opened all the keycaps then cleans the juice with a cotton q-tip swab then cleaned all the keys by putting them in water and drying everything out after i reassembled my keyboard and it is working fine but the leds randomly turn on for different letters im not sure how to stop this

for example the type and such is fine the only problem is my keyboard has lights on the keycaps but now they just randomly turn on and start flickering if theres any way to fix this please let me know
 
Solution
This would be a problem with the keyboard's circuit board, not the key switches themselves, which have no RGB built into them, nor do they handle determining when the keyboard lights (the keyboard itself is deciding when and where to light based on when it receives the simple signal from the switch). If you've cleaned the circuit board itself and it was dry, it's unlikely that it's anything that can be resolved at this point.
